Adrenal Gland (cont’d) �Adrenal medulla secretes catecholamines: � Epinephrine � Norepinephrine �Adrenal cortex secretes corticosteroids � Glucocorticoids � Mineralocorticoids (primarily aldosterone) � All adrenal cortex hormones are steroid hormones

Mechanism of Action �Most exert their effects by modifying enzyme activity �Different drugs differ in their potency, duration of action, and the extent to which they cause salt and fluid retention �Glucocorticoids inhibit or help control inflammatory and immune responses

Indications �Wide variety of indications �Adrenocortical deficiency �Cerebral edema �Collagen diseases �Dermatologic diseases �GI diseases �Exacerbations of chronic respiratory illnesses, such as asthma and COPD

Indications (cont’d) �Organ transplant (decrease immune response) �Palliative management of leukemias and lymphomas �Spinal cord injury �Many other indications

Indications (cont’d) �Glucocorticoids given: �By inhalation for control of steroid-responsive bronchospastic states �Nasally for rhinitis and to prevent the recurrence of polyps after surgical removal �Topically for inflammations of the eye, ear, and skin

Indications (cont’d) Antiadrenals (adrenal steroid inhibitors) �Aminoglutethimide �Used in the treatment of Cushing’s syndrome �Metyrapone �Used as a diagnostic drug to assess ACTH production

Contraindications �Drug allergies �Serious infections, including septicemia, systemic fungal infections, and varicella �However, in the presence of tuberculous meningitis, glucocorticoids may be used to prevent inflammatory CNS damage

Adverse Effects �Potent effects on all body systems � Cardiovascular � Heart failure, cardiac edema, hypertension—all due to electrolyte imbalances (hyperkalemia, hypernatremia) � CNS � Convulsions, headache, vertigo, mood swings, nervousness, insomnia, “steroid psychosis, ” others

Adverse Effects (cont’d) �Potent effects on all body systems �Endocrine � Growth suppression, Cushing’s syndrome, menstrual irregularities, carbohydrate intolerance, hyperglycemia, others �GI � Peptic ulcers with possible perforation, pancreatitis, abdominal distention, others

Adverse Effects (cont’d) �Potent effects on all body systems �Integumentary � Fragile skin, petechiae, ecchymosis, facial erythema, poor wound healing, hirsutism, urticaria �Musculoskeletal � Muscle weakness, loss of muscle mass, osteoporosis

Nursing Implications �Perform a physical assessment to determine baseline weight, height, intake and output status, vital signs (especially BP), hydration status, immune status �Obtain baseline laboratory studies �Assess for edema and electrolyte imbalances

Nursing Implications (cont’d) �Assess for contraindications to adrenal drugs, especially the presence of peptic ulcer disease �Assess for drug allergies and potential drug interactions (prescription and OTC) �Be aware that these drugs may alter serum glucose and electrolyte levels

Nursing Implications (cont’d) �Systemic forms may be given by oral, IM, IV, or rectal routes (not SC) �Prepare and administer according to manufacturer’s directions �Oral forms should be given with food or milk to minimize GI upset

Nursing Implications (cont’d) �For topical applications, follow instructions about use and type of dressing, if any, to apply �Clear nasal passages before giving a nasal corticosteroid

Nursing Implications (cont’d) �After using an inhaled corticosteroid, instruct patients to rinse their mouths to prevent possible oral fungal infections �Teach patients on corticosteroids to avoid contact with people with infections and to report any fever, increased weakness, lethargy, or sore throat

Nursing Implications (cont’d) Patients should be taught to take all adrenal medications at the same time every day, usually in the morning, with meals or food Do not take with alcohol, aspirin, NSAIDs

Nursing Implications (cont’d) �Sudden discontinuation of these drugs can precipitate an adrenal crisis caused by a sudden drop in serum levels of cortisone �Doses are usually tapered before the drug is discontinued �Monitor for therapeutic responses �Monitor for adverse effects
